The Education of Little Tree
If you haven't seen this movie yet then you really really must! Its about an 8yr old boy sent to his grandparents to live after his parents die. They live in the mountains of TN in the 1930's and the movie has lots of wonderful scenery of the different seasons besides having a great story of all the joy, setbacks and adventures this boy has each day.
